If you feel mentally cloudy, easily overwhelmed, or like your brain just isn’t keeping up with your life, this episode will help you understand why - and what actually helps remedy it.
In this conversation, we explore brain fog as a whole-body signal rather than a mysterious mental flaw. You’ll learn why so many people experience foggy thinking even when tests look “normal,” and how this pattern often overlaps with chronic fatigue and nervous system depletion.
We break down the root causes behind mental fatigue, including inflammation, sleep deprivation, hormonal imbalances and metabolic stress. From there, we look at how strategic nourishment can reduce inflammation and support the brain in a way that feels grounded and realistic.
This episode highlights how a thoughtfully designed healthy diet influences circadian rhythms, metabolism, gut health, and immune signaling—all of which play a role in restoring focus and energy. We also discuss why persistent low energy is often a sign that your body needs regulation and support, not more pushing.
You’ll hear how rebuilding the nervous system and calming neuroinflammation can unlock real mental clarity, especially when food, herbs, and body-mind practices work together. This is a deeply holistic health approach that treats brain fog as a systemic experience requiring a systemic solution.
